Introduction

Appropriate ammo storage is important for preserving functionality, protection, and trustworthiness with time. Whether you stockpile for self-defense, hunting, or survival functions, improper storage may result in corrosion, misfires, or maybe risky malfunctions.

This manual covers essential recommendations, storage approaches, and environmental variables which can effects ammunition longevity.

one. Retail store Ammo in a Awesome, Dry Place

Humidity and heat are your major enemies when storing ammunition.
Keep the ammo far from damp basements, garages, and attics exactly where dampness accumulates.
A constant temperature concerning 50–70°F (ten–21°C) is ideal.
Use local weather-controlled parts similar to a gun Harmless, storage closet, or ammo canister inside your house.

two. Preserve Ammo Clear of Direct Daylight
UV rays and warmth can break down powder and primers after a while.
Steer clear of storing ammo near windows, cars, or uncovered areas.
Use opaque containers or ammo cans which has a reliable seal to dam light publicity.

3. Use Airtight Containers to forestall Dampness
Ammo cans with rubber gaskets create an airtight seal that keeps dampness out.
Plastic storage bins with silica gel packs might also assist lower humidity inside of.
Vacuum-sealing ammo in Mylar bags with desiccant packets provides an extra layer of security.

4. Add Desiccant Packs to soak up Dampness
Silica gel packs avoid condensation and rust by absorbing humidity.
Put a handful of packets inside ammo cans or storage boxes.
Substitute silica packs each 6–twelve months for best humidity Regulate.

five. Rotate Ammo Often (Very first In, First Out Rule)
Oldest ammo need to be utilised initially to keep up a new provide.
Label storage containers with buy dates to track shelf daily life.
Rotate stock at the very least yearly for apply capturing or teaching.

six. Steer clear of Storing Ammo on the ground
Concrete flooring bring in humidity, leading to corrosion and primer failure.
Retail store ammo on cabinets, racks, or pallets to forestall exposure to damp surfaces.
Wooden or plastic platforms perform well in basements or gun rooms.

7. Retain Ammo Different from Cleaning Solvents and Chemical substances
Gun-cleansing solvents, oils, and substances can harm primer integrity if stored also shut.
Separate ammo from household cleaners, gasoline, and robust-smelling substances.
Use sealed ammo containers in a special cabinet or storage unit.

eight. Retailer Distinctive Calibers Separately
Mixing various calibers can result in misloads or confusion.
Use labeled containers or ammo trays to keep rounds arranged.
If storing bulk ammo, separate by model, sort, and grain fat.

9. Shield Against Corrosion with Anti-Rust Measures
Metallic ammunition casings can rust after a while if subjected to dampness.
Use a light coat of gun oil to steel casings just before extensive-expression storage.
Store in climate-managed regions with reduced humidity concentrations.

10. Utilize a Dehumidifier in Storage Regions
A little dehumidifier minimizes humidity in gun safes, storage rooms, or closets.
Select a renewable desiccant dehumidifier for small-maintenance moisture Command.
Keep an eye on humidity levels by using a hygrometer (great variety: thirty–fifty%).

eleven. Continue to keep Ammo in Manufacturing facility Packaging for Maximum Longevity
Manufacturing facility-sealed bins supply a limited seal versus contaminants.
Avoid repacking ammo in non-sealed bags or cardboard bins.
If repackaging, use vacuum-sealed bags or ammo cans with desiccant packs.

twelve. Fireproof and Lock Ammo for Security
Store ammo in a fireproof Harmless or cupboard to safeguard towards fireplace dangers.
Lock ammo separately from firearms to stop unauthorized entry.
Decide on a UL-rated fireproof safe with warmth resistance in excess of 1,two hundred°F (650°C).

thirteen. Inspect Ammo Periodically for Signs of harm
Search for corrosion, discoloration, or deformities on casings.
Check out primers for dents, leaks, or free seating.
Discard any weakened or questionable rounds properly.

Frequently Requested Thoughts (FAQs)
one. How long can ammunition past if saved adequately?
Ammo can very last a long time if saved in a great, dry, and sealed setting. Some well-preserved rounds have remained functional for over 50 several years.

two. Can I retail store ammo in my auto?
Not suggested. Serious heat and humidity inside an auto can degrade powder and primers, lowering dependability.

three. What happens if ammo receives soaked?
Drinking water publicity can harm primers and powder, causing misfires or failures. If ammo will get soaked, let it dry entirely, but discard any corroded rounds.

four. Can it be Secure to store ammo inside of a garage?
Not best. Temperature fluctuations and humidity may cause corrosion and primer failure. If important, use airtight ammo cans with desiccant packs.

5. How can I tell if ammo has gone poor?
Signs of undesirable ammo incorporate corroded casings, deformed bullets, free primers, or Odd odors within the powder.

six. Need to I vacuum-seal my ammo for storage?
Sure! Vacuum-sealing with desiccant packs may also help avoid dampness and air publicity, extending ammo lifespan.
